Overview
The days when customer service, IT, Human Resources, engineering, operations and construction could operate in silos is drawing to close. Smart Grid implementation is a key reason for this change. While specialised knowledge will be necessary in each of these disciplines, knowledge of the big picture and the ability to work in ways that cut across the organisation will be an absolute requirement in the future.
This master class covers aspects of the Smart Grid that touch all departments in the utility. It is suitable for participants from any of these disciplines. This four day course will help you and your organisation to build the big picture along with practical information and lessons learnt to succeed on the next generation energy supply system.
